When we say “smarter lighting controls,” we are talking about features such as timers, dimmers, programmable scenes, and app-based or smart-home control. These tools give you more control over brightness, timing, and zones, so your lights support your evenings rather than interrupt them.

How Smart Controls Transform Backyard Living
Smarter controls let you fine-tune your system so it supports different activities without constant tinkering. The main options usually include:
- Dimmers to adjust brightness for comfort and mood
- Zone control to manage different parts of the yard independently
- Motion and ambient light sensors to react to movement and changing light levels
- Programmable timers so lights follow your schedule automatically
- App and voice control tied into smart-home systems
In Winston-Salem, that might look like dimmed patio lights for late-night conversations, with brighter task lighting over the grill only when you need it. Pathway and step lights can respond to motion so they come on as you walk through the yard, rather than glowing for hours when nobody is outside.
For Greensboro families, zone control can keep play areas bright while keeping softer light near bedroom windows for kids who are trying to sleep. A simple app or voice command can switch from a relaxed “weeknight” scene to a “party” scene that brings more light to seating areas and walkways when guests arrive.

Saving Energy While Highlighting Your Landscape
Smart controls work best when paired with efficient LED fixtures. Compared with older halogen or incandescent systems, LEDs use less power and typically last longer, which cuts down on replacement and maintenance. When those LEDs are connected to smart dimmers and timers, the savings can be even greater because the lights only run when and where you want them.
Zoning is especially helpful for Greensboro homeowners who want their lighting to be both beautiful and practical. Instead of flooding the entire yard, you can:
- Highlight specific trees, shrubs, and flower beds
- Accent architectural features, such as brickwork or columns
- Focus light on outdoor kitchens, fire pits, or seating areas
- Keep side yards and less-used corners on lower settings or shorter schedules
By dimming decorative areas later at night and keeping only key security or safety zones active, you reduce wasted light and avoid paying for electricity you do not truly need. The result is a more sustainable approach to enjoying your outdoor spaces and a system that respects both your budget and the environment.
